At New Spirit Recovery, we want to provide addiction treatment to those who are in need of help and want to live a better and healthier life. Contact us today to speak to one of our addiction treatment professionals and see how we can help!

Our Office

17856 Cathedral Pl, Encino, CA 91316

Call Us

+1 (855) 605-1069

Email Address

Get In Touch

Calls are over the phone consultations are always free of charge and your conversation with us is confidential. The road to recovery should never be traveled alone, let us help you take those first steps toward a better life.

Verify Your Insurance